Новости

«Базис» обновил конструктор сервисов: шаблоны, гибкая безопасность и интеграция с защитой виртуализации

Компания «Базис» анонсировала выход версии 2.4 конструктора платформенных сервисов Basis Automation Studio — модуля, который является частью расширенной версии облачной платформы Basis Dynamix Cloud Control. В новом обновлении реализована интеграция со средством защиты виртуализации Basis Virtual Security, гибкая ролевая модель, а также возможность работы с внешними системами версионирования через веб-интерфейс.

Basis Automation Studio представляет собой среду для автоматизации развертывания сервисов, оснащенную инструментами визуального проектирования виртуальной инфраструктуры на основе готовых компонентов и связей между ними. Конструктор включает расширяемый каталог шаблонов виртуальных инфраструктур и платформенных сервисов, а также расширяемую библиотеку компонентов с примерами популярного ПО, таких как ClickHouse, Consul, Docker, MariaDB, PostgreSQL и других. Процесс развертывания базируется на архитектуре TOSCA с применением языков YAML, Ansible, Python и Bash.

Одним из главных нововведений релиза стала интеграция конструктора с решением для защиты Basis Virtual Security. Конструктор использует Basis Virtual Security как единого провайдера идентификации, что позволяет администраторам централизованно управлять учетными записями и правами доступа пользователей, а также поддерживает технологию единого входа (Single Sign-On, SSO). Благодаря этому можно централизованно применять политики безопасности, что уменьшает нагрузку на администраторов и избавляет пользователей платформы от необходимости вводить учетные данные при перемещении между компонентами экосистемы «Базиса».

В Basis Automation Studio 2.4, помимо существующей ролевой модели, была представлена ее улучшенная версия, позволяющая гибко настраивать права доступа пользователей: администратор может создавать собственные роли из атомарных разрешений и назначать их в нужном объеме конкретным пользователям. Переход на новую модель уже реализован на уровне архитектуры конструктора.

В новой версии Basis Automation Studio появилась возможность загружать компоненты и шаблоны сервисов из Git-репозиториев. Загрузка и обновление компонентов и шаблонов осуществляется через графический интерфейс по выбранному Git-тегу с возможностью пакетной загрузки. Поддерживаются различные способы аутентификации (пароль, токен). Загруженный компонент или шаблон сервиса поддерживает версионирование, позволяя обновлять их как вперед, так и назад.

Таким образом, веб-портал продолжает развиваться как единая точка для работы с конструктором. Ранее в него уже были добавлены инструменты для создания и редактирования компонентов и шаблонов. В обновленной версии конструктора появилась интеграция с внешними Git-репозиториями. Благодаря этому разработка TOSCA-шаблонов может быть встроена в привычные для команд процессы работы с исходным кодом, обеспечивается отслеживаемость изменений и упрощается коллективная работа над каталогом сервисов.

В новом релизе также была добавлена возможность оценки ресурсов для уже развернутых сервисов. Это позволяет пользователям анализировать их ресурсные потребности и более точно планировать дальнейшую эксплуатацию.

«Основная задача, которую Basis Automation Studio решает для бизнеса, — это упрощение развертывания ИТ-систем и сервисов внутри виртуального ЦОД. Именно поэтому мы развиваем продукт сразу в нескольких направлениях, связанных с этой целью. В частности, мы уже внедрили централизованное управление доступом через интеграцию с другим нашим продуктом, Basis Virtual Security, а также обеспечили более гибкое разграничение прав пользователей и включили конструктор в стандартные процессы разработки за счет поддержки Git в веб-портале», — заявил Дмитрий Сорокин, технический директор компании «Базис».

Поделиться:

0 Комментариев

Оставить комментарий

Обязательные поля помечены *
Ваш комментарий *
Категории
Популярные новости